Why Google’s AI Overviews Don’t Replace SEO — They Reinforce It

If you’ve noticed Google showing AI-generated summaries at the top of search results, you’re seeing the new AI Overviews in action — part of Google’s ongoing evolution of search, powered by its Search Generative Experience (SGE).

Understandably, many business owners and marketers worry this change could make traditional SEO obsolete. After all, if Google summarises answers directly on the page, won’t users stop clicking through to websites?

The truth is the exact opposite.

AI Overviews don’t replace SEO — they reinforce it. They’re designed to reward trusted, authoritative, and technically sound websites that deliver value to users.

Here’s why that matters more than ever in 2025.

1. The Rise of AI Overviews

Google’s AI Overviews are AI-powered summaries that appear at the top of search results, pulling information from multiple online sources.

Using advanced machine learning and natural language processing, these overviews provide users with quick, contextual answers. But — and this is crucial — Google still relies on high-quality websites to source that information.

In other words, your content still fuels what AI displays. The difference is that only credible, well-optimised sites make it into those AI-generated snapshots.

2. How Google Chooses Which Content Appears

AI Overviews don’t scrape random pages — they select content from websites that demonstrate:

✅ Expertise, Experience,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ness (E-E-A-T)

✅ Clear structure and logical formatting

✅ Topic depth and semantic relevance

✅ Strong engagement metrics (clicks, dwell time, backlinks, etc.)

That means if your business invests in strong SEO foundations — quality content, clean site architecture, and authentic backlinks — you’re already optimising for AI-driven search.

5. How to Optimise for AI Overviews

To stay visible, businesses must evolve their SEO strategies. Here’s how to future-proof your content for Google’s AI Overviews:

a) Strengthen E-E-A-T Signals

  • Highlight author expertise and business credentials.
  • Include “About” pages, verified contact details, and links to credible sources.
  • Use authentic case studies or first-hand experiences.

b) Focus on Intent, Not Just Keywords

  • AI Overviews prioritise context. Write content that answers why and how, not just what.
  • Cover questions users naturally ask: comparisons, benefits, pricing, or best practices.

c) Use Structured Data (Schema Markup)

  • Add FAQ, HowTo, and LocalBusiness schema to help Google interpret your pages more accurately.

d) Keep Content Fresh and Comprehensive

  • Update your most visited pages regularly.
  • Expand articles with visuals, statistics, and references that demonstrate topical depth.

e) Maintain Technical Excellence

  • Ensure your site loads fast, is mobile-friendly, and uses HTTPS.
  • Fix crawl errors and optimise your internal linking.

These technical and contextual improvements directly influence how AI perceives and cites your content.

6. The Shift from Keywords to Context

In the age of AI, SEO isn’t about chasing single keywords — it’s about building semantic relevance.

AI Overviews interpret intent, relationships, and meaning. That’s why content clusters (interconnected articles around one main topic) are now one of the most powerful SEO strategies.

For example, instead of one blog about “SEO tools,” build a cluster covering:

  • “Best free SEO tools for small businesses”
  • “How to measure SEO ROI”
  • “AI-driven keyword research in 2025”

This approach signals authority and helps AI — and users — understand your depth of expertise.

7. Measuring SEO Success in the AI Era

Traditional SEO metrics still matter — but you’ll also want to track how your content performs within AI Overviews.

Key performance indicators now include:

  • Inclusion in AI snapshots (using emerging SEO tools).
  • Click-throughs from AI-sourced citations.
  • Branded search growth (a sign your visibility is improving).
  • Engagement rates from long-tail content that answers AI-level queries.

SEO success in 2025 is measured not just by ranking, but by recognition — being the trusted source AI uses to inform search results.
